We report on the ROSAT HRI observations of three Galactic Center hard X-ray sources discovered by the ART-P/SIGMA experiments aboard the GRANAT satellite, namely GRS1734-292, GRS1747-341, and GRS1743-290. We found a possible counterpart for GRS1734-292 located at a position α=17h37m28.2s and δ= -29deg08'03.1" (equinox 2000) with an associated error radius of 3arcsec (90% confidence level). The HRI X-ray flux is consistent with previous measurements by ART-P. This variable source was also clearly detected during two PSPC pointed observations of the Galactic Center region. Although the significance of our detection is low (~3σ), we may have also an X-ray counterpart for the persistent SIGMA source GRS1747-341; its position would be α=17h50m55.0s and δ=-34d11'37.0" (equinox 2000) with an associated error radius of 5.5arcsec (90% confidence level). On the other hand, we failed to detect GRS1743-290; another source which displays persistent emission in the SIGMA hard X-ray band. This result is consistent with the source being highly absorbed as suggested by previous observations.
